The standard procedure to fix something in Linux seems to be to implement a library that hides the problems in the original design. Then somebody else comes with yet another library that runs on top of the first one and fixes the problems in it. This process gets repeated until nobody can manage the situation. Then some brilliant developer starts from the beginning. Few years ago ALSA was supposed to be the ultimate solution. Then Jack became THE solution. Now PulseAudio is hot. Some users prefer Gstreamer. Earlier we had ESD and many other similar subsystems. What will come next?
